Type Ahead did not suggest construct query and file on CSV import
FNakano opened this issue · comments
I tried to import CSV data using [LinkedDataHub] User guide - CSV import
video and https://atomgraph.github.io/LinkedDataHub/linkeddatahub/docs/reference/imports/csv/#vocabulary-conversion as references.
- Created a
countries.csv
file from https://atomgraph.github.io/LinkedDataHub/linkeddatahub/docs/reference/imports/csv/#vocabulary-conversion fist file listing; - Created a construct query from https://atomgraph.github.io/LinkedDataHub/linkeddatahub/docs/reference/imports/csv/#vocabulary-conversion third file listing
- Tried to create a CSV Import: typeahead for
file
andquery
did not suggest any file nor query (screenshot below).
Also tried capitalizing first letter, same result.
Curiously, typeahead suggested a constructor (not a construct query)
Thanks for the report, will investigate ASAP. If you could provide the Docker log leading up to the typeahead ( docker-compose logs --tail 500 linkeddatahub
) it would be helpful.
Hello!
Procedure to get the log:
- Removed the CSV import resource created in the previous tries;
- Removed the File resource;
- Removed the CONSTRUCT queries related to the issue.
From this clean(?) start:
- In the Root container, create new File, get
countries.csv
from the filesystem, Label itcountries
; - In the Root container, create new CONSTRUCT, fill in the query text with the query from https://atomgraph.github.io/LinkedDataHub/linkeddatahub/docs/reference/imports/csv/, label it
countries
; - In the Root container, create new CSV Import;
4. Type 'cou' in File text box (got no suggestion);
5. Type 'cou' in Query text box (got no suggestion); - Generate log with
docker-compose logs --tail 500 linkeddatahub >importCSV-typeahead-issue-138.log
importCSV-typeahead-issue-138.log
:)
@FNakano this could be to the broken multiple-type support in the typeahead component which went unnoticed for some time. I fixed this accidentally in the develop
branch just a few days ago :) Would you be able to try this with the latest develop
code?
Now released as 3.2.23 and on master
as well.
@FNakano this could be to the broken multiple-type support in the typeahead component which went unnoticed for some time. I fixed this accidentally in the
develop
branch just a few days ago :) Would you be able to try this with the latestdevelop
code?
Hello!
Tried the develop
branch a few minutes ago. Typeahead do suggest.
I'm going to try the latest release...
Hello!
Yes! TypeAhead in master branch showed the same suggestions.
I'm going to close the issue...
... it is a somehow related doubt:
Which one should I choose - the ArchiveItem or the FileDataObject?
Thank you!